Clevenger Named USTFCCCA Division III Athlete of the Week; Second Prof in as Many Weeks to Claim the Honor

GLASSBORO, NJ -- Seth Clevenger was selected as the Division III Men's Track & Field National Athlete of the Week by the USTFCCCA for the week ending January 25th.

Clevenger is the second Prof to earn the weekly national honor in a row after the transfer broke two school records and placed in the all-time Division III record book.

At last weekend's Dr. Sander Scorcher hosted by Columbia at the NYC Armory, Clevenger clocked in at 7:54.87 in the 3000 meters for the new #1 time in DIII and became the second person to hit sub-eight minutes in the event. His time breaks the old program record of 8:15.29 set in 2018 (Kevin Veltre). The following day at the same meet, Clevenger hit a new program time and top DIII mark in the mile (4:02.76). The 14th fastest results in DIII history, the time breaks the previous best of 4:11.05 set in 2024 (Scott Hubbard).

Clevenger was also named the NJAC Men's Track & Field Track Athlete of the Week as well.

Last week, Dallas Hohney was cited with the award as he set a new Division III record in the 500 meters.

The Profs will travel to Staten Island, NY for the METS Championships at Ocean Breeze on Friday.
